How Our Laundry Room Water Removal Service Works
When you call us for Laundry Room Water Removal, our team will spring into action to mitigate the damage and prevent further problems. We’ll assess the situation, extract the water, and dry your space to prevent mold and mildew growth.
Step 1: Assessment and Extraction
Our team will quickly assess the situation and extract the water using specialized equipment. We’ll remove any standing water, wet carpets, and damaged materials to prevent further damage.
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ification
Next, we’ll use industrial-strength fans and dehumidifiers to dry your space and prevent moisture buildup. This step is crucial to prevent mold and mildew growth.
Step 3: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
We’ll sanitize and disinfect your space to ensure a healthy environment for you and your family. Our team uses eco-friendly products to ensure a safe and healthy space.
Step 4: Restoration and Repair
Finally, our team will repair and restore your laundry room to its original condition. We’ll replace any damaged materials and ensure your space is safe and functional.

Laundry Room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 10 gallons) | Yes | No | You can likely handle a small spill with some towels and a wet vacuum. |
| Large water spill (more than 10 gallons) | No | Yes | Large water spills need spec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age. |
| Standing water (over 1 inch deep) | No | Yes | Standing water can cause serious damage and needs prompt attention from a professional. |
| Mold or mildew growth | No | Yes | Mold and mildew growth need specialized equipment and expertise to safely remove and prevent further growth. |
| Water damage to electrical systems or appliances | No | Yes | Water damage to electrical systems or appliances needs prompt attention from a professional to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|

Laundry Room Water Removal Cost In Dewey, OK
The cost of Laundry Room Water Removal services in Dewey, OK varies dep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for our services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The cost of water extraction depends on the amount of water and the equipment required.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The cost of drying and dehumidification depends on the size of the affected area and the equipment required. |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$200 – $1,000 | The cost of sanitizing and disinfecting depends on the size of the affected area and the products required. |
| Restoration and Rep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| The cost of restoration and repair depends on the extent of the damage and the materials required. |
